KHAO PAD ROD FAI (ข้าวผัดรถไฟ) – THAI “RAILWAY” FRIED RICE
Khao Pad Rod Fai (ข้าวผัดรถไฟ) is one of Thailand’s most iconic fried rice dishes, commonly found at street stalls and small eateries near train stations.
The name “Rod Fai” literally means “train” in Thai, referring to the original locations where this dish was served — quick, flavorful meals for travelers and workers near the railway.
Today, Khao Pad Rod Fai is loved all around the world for its bold, smoky flavor and rich aroma that perfectly capture the essence of Thai street food.
Ingredients and Characteristics
The heart of Khao Pad Rod Fai is fragrant jasmine rice, stir-fried over high heat with fresh vegetables, meat, and sauces that create a deep, slightly smoky flavor.
At NiyomThai, our version includes:
- Vegetables: carrot, onion, garlic, spring onion, bell pepper, and green peas
- Protein options: pork, chicken, shrimp, or seafood (talay)
- Seasonings: soy sauce, fish sauce (nam pla), oyster sauce, palm sugar, and optionally a touch of chili paste
The secret lies in quick stir-frying at very high temperature, which keeps the rice fluffy and the vegetables crisp.
We serve the dish with fresh cucumber slices, coriander, and lime wedges, which add a refreshing balance to the savory and slightly sweet notes.
How We Prepare Khao Pad Rod Fai
- Cook the rice – ideally a day in advance, so it stays fluffy and doesn’t stick when fried.
- Sauté the vegetables – heat vegetable oil in a wok, add chopped onion, garlic, and spring onion, then stir in carrot and bell pepper.
- Add the protein – cook pork, chicken, shrimp, or seafood until golden and aromatic.
- Combine with rice – add the cooked jasmine rice and gently mix to combine all ingredients.
- Season – pour in soy sauce, fish sauce, oyster sauce, and a bit of palm sugar. For a spicy touch, add chili paste or fresh chilies.
- Serve immediately – garnish with cucumber slices, fresh coriander, and lime wedges.
